voila c'est mon premier Scan Ircop, bon j'attend vos reproches pour l'amélioré :p, mais bon en tout cas il fonctionne bien.
Source / Exemple :
alias Ircop { $iif($dialog(Ircop),dialog -x Ircop,dialog -m Ircop Ircop) }
dialog Ircop {
title "- Scan Ircop - [ /Ircop ]"
size -1 -1 97 134
option dbu
list 1, 7 11 83 85, size vsbar
button "Fermer", 2, 3 123 90 10, flat ok
box "Scan Serveur", 4, 2 1 92 99
button "Whois", 15, 3 101 39 10, flat
button "Query", 16, 54 101 39 10, flat
button "Rafraichir", 18, 3 112 90 10, flat
}
On *:dialog:Ircop:*:*:{
If ($devent == Init) {
who 0 o
Echo -a Scan en cours..
Echo -a Scan Effectué sur14 $server - Ip serveur :14 $serverip - Network :14 $network $+ .
}
Elseif ($devent == Sclick) {
if ($did = 18) { did -r $dname 1 | who 0 o }
Elseif ($did = 15) { if ($did(1).sel) { whois $did(1).seltext } }
Elseif ($did = 16) { if ($did(1).sel) { query $did(1).seltext } }
}
Elseif ($devent == dclick) {
if ($did(1).sel) whois $did(1).seltext
}
}
raw 352:*:if ($dialog(Ircop)) { did -a IRCOP 1 $6 | halt } | else { echo -a $6 | halt }
Conclusion :
...
Vous n'êtes pas encore membre ?
inscrivez-vous, c'est gratuit et ça prend moins d'une minute !
Les membres obtiennent plus de réponses que les utilisateurs anonymes.
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.
Le fait d'être membre vous permet d'avoir des options supplémentaires.